Other Media and Communication Worker Salary Information in Michigan

The average annual salaries for other media and communication workers in the state of Michigan are shown in Table 1. The comparison of the salary statistics of other media and communication workers among Michigan metropolitan areas is shown in Table 2. The salary statistics are based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].

Table 1 & 2. Annual Salary of Other Media and Communication Workers in Michigan (2022 Survey)

Percentile bracketAverage annual salary
10th Percentile Wage
$33,490
25th Percentile Wage
$39,090
50th Percentile Wage
$51,340
75th Percentile Wage
$63,800
90th Percentile Wage
$78,660

Table 1 shows the average annual salary for other media and communication workers in Michigan in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$78,660.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$51,340.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ent is $33,490.

Table 3. Median Annual Salary of Other Media and Communication Workers in Michigan Cities (2022 Survey)

Table 3 shows the median annual salary of other media and communication workers in some Michigan cities and metropolitan areas. We note that the median annual salary of other media and communication workers in state of Michigan ranges from $26,170 to $54,430. The highest paying area for other media and communication workers in Michigan is Detroit-Warren-Livonia with a median annual salary of $54,430. The second highest paying city/area in Michigan State is Grand Rapids-Wyoming (mean annual salary $47,650). The lowest paying area is Ann Arbor with a median annual salary of $26,170.

Cities/Areas Median Annual Salary
Detroit-Warren-Livonia
$54,430
Grand Rapids-Wyoming
$47,650
Detroit-Livonia-Dearborn
$34,960
Warren-Troy-Farmington Hills
$27,890
Ann Arbor
$26,170
